Why Condensed Boldness Wins in Digital Feeds
In digital advertising, space is a premium commodity. Whether you are designing a Pinterest pin, a YouTube thumbnail, or an email banner, you are fighting for pixels. A wide, traditional typeface often forces you to reduce the font size to fit your headline, which kills readability on smaller devices. Nevanty’s condensed style solves this mechanical problem elegantly. By narrowing the character width while maintaining a heavy weight, it allows for larger point sizes within constrained horizontal spaces.
This is not just about fitting more text; it is about impact. When we swapped our generic header text for Nevanty in our social media graphics, the hierarchy shifted instantly. The headlines became the dominant visual element, guiding the viewer’s eye straight to the core message before they even processed the image details. This is crucial for social media graphics where users decide to stop scrolling in less than a second. Readability and Mobile-First Design
A common mistake in modern typography is sacrificing legibility for style. With highly stylized display fonts, this is a real risk. However, Nevanty maintains excellent readability because it avoids excessive decorative flourishes that can blur at small sizes. When preparing assets for mobile-first campaigns, I always test previews at 50% zoom. Nevanty held up remarkably well. The open counters and distinct letterforms prevent characters from merging together, a frequent issue with condensed fonts.
For image overlays, contrast is key. We found that Nevanty worked exceptionally well in white against dark, saturated backgrounds, as well as in deep charcoal against light pastels. The bold weight ensures that the text does not get lost in the noise of complex photography. If you are designing for fast-scrolling feeds, this clarity is non-negotiable. Your audience should not have to squint to understand your value proposition.
Strategic Font Pairing for Depth
While Nevanty shines as a headline hero, a complete design system requires supporting actors. Because Nevanty is a strong presence, it pairs best with neutral, unobtrusive body text. In our campaign templates, we paired it with a clean, geometric sans serif font for body copy. This created a clear distinction between the "voice" of the brand (loud, cheerful, bold) and the "information" (clear, calm, readable).
For more artistic projects, such as packaging design or limited-edition promotional posters, you might experiment with pairing Nevanty with a delicate script font or a handwritten font. The contrast between the rigid, condensed structure of Nevanty and the fluidity of a script can create a dynamic, high-end aesthetic. However, for daily digital ads and web content, keeping the pairing simple ensures that the message remains the focus. Avoid pairing it with another condensed or overly decorative typeface, as this will create visual tension and reduce comprehension.
